Transaction 53af59f804e7e2fa9e8ce3c865f6e55a8609487bef1d6ae2c37e2890208a7f0b
1 Input
1 Output
-
53af59f804e7e2fa9e8ce3c865f6e55a8609487bef1d6ae2c37e2890208a7f0b:0
- value
- 37510719
- script pubkey
- OP_0 OP_PUSHBYTES_20 f7b9b6df758cdd991f2c3e10b5f3127c4910a6da
- address
- bc1q77umdhm43nwej8ev8cgttucj03y3pfk6mcwyud